Marseilles

Marseilles was a hologram, based on Tom Paris, that was a character in a holonovel written by The Doctor entitled Photons Be Free.

He was the helmsman of the USS Vortex. In "Chapter 1: A Healer is Born", Marseilles was brought to sickbay by Commander Katanay with a slight concussion, having been injured during the incident with the Caretaker. When the person playing the EMH refused to treat Marseilles first, wanting to see to a more seriously injured patient, Captain Jenkins would kill the other patient so that Marseilles would be treated. He was a womanizer, although he was married to Torrey, a character based on Paris' wife B'Elanna Torres. The Doctor described the character as being self-indulgent and immature when compared to the real Paris. (VOY: "Author, Author")

The character name "Marseilles" was derived from the city of Marseille, France. Tom Paris spent much time playing pool in a tavern called Sandrine's in Marseille. (Paris later re-created Sandrine's on Voyager's holodeck in 2371, stardate 48546.2.) (VOY: "The Cloud")

Like Paris, Marseilles was portrayed by Robert Duncan McNeill.
The name appears to have been chosen as a joke, since Marseilles is a city in France, as is Paris.
